Souqly is an intuitive eCommerce platform designed to help entrepreneurs and small businesses quickly establish their online presence. With a focus on simplicity and accessibility, Souqly enables users across Palestine and the Arab world to create professional online stores in just minutes, without any coding or technical expertise. The platform streamlines the entire selling process—adding products, customizing storefronts, managing orders, and accepting online payments—within a single, user-friendly interface. Its regional focus makes it particularly valuable for local entrepreneurs seeking tailored eCommerce solutions, removing the complexities often associated with online selling and empowering businesses to expand their reach and boost sales rapidly.

LocateStore simplifies the process of creating interactive store locators by transforming Google Sheets into mobile-friendly maps. Designed for multi-location brands, it allows users to add store addresses directly into a Google Sheet and instantly generate a customizable map with search and filter options. Its seamless integration means no coding, API keys, or complex setup is required, making it accessible for small businesses and enterprise brands alike. The real-time sync ensures that any updates to the spreadsheet are immediately reflected on the map, facilitating easy management of multiple store locations. Its embed capability allows businesses to incorporate the locator directly into their websites effortlessly, enhancing the local shopping experience for customers. Overall, LocateStore offers a straightforward, efficient solution for brands seeking an easy-to-maintain store locator that adapts to their evolving needs.
